微信小程序轮播图是一种强大的视觉展示工具,能够通过动态切换图片,为用户带来丰富的视觉体验,它利用小程序的灵活性和便捷性,轻松实现图片的自动播放、手动滑动以及自定义切换效果,满足各种场景下的展示需求,轮播图还支持响应式设计,适应不同屏幕尺寸,确保在手机、平板等设备上都能呈现出最佳效果,通过搭配加载动画、背景音乐等元素,轮播图更能增强用户体验,提升品牌形象。
在这个快节奏、高效率的时代,大众对数字产品的需求不断增长,微信小程序凭借其轻量级、便捷性和强大的社交属性,已然成为众多企业和个人开发者的关注焦点,在微信小程序中,轮播图作为一种直观、生动的展示方式,被广泛应用于各种场景,如产品展示、广告推广、新闻资讯等,这篇文章小编将深入探讨微信小程序轮播图的实现原理、功能特点以及优化策略,旨在帮助开发者更好地掌握这一实用工具。
微信小程序轮播图的实现原理
微信小程序轮播图的核心在于通过预设的图片序列和自动播放机制,结合用户交互操作,实现图片的流畅切换和展示,开发者需要借助微信小程序提供的API和组件,如经过无论兄弟们的要求,我对原文进行了修正和优化,下面内容是修改后的内容:
在这个快节奏、高效率的时代,大众对数字产品的需求不断增长,微信小程序凭借其轻量级、便捷性和强大的社交属性,已然成为众多企业和个人开发者的关注焦点,在微信小程序中,轮播图作为一种直观、生动的展示方式,被广泛应用于各种场景,如产品展示、广告推广、新闻资讯等,这篇文章小编将深入探讨微信小程序轮播图的实现原理、功能特点以及优化策略,旨在帮助开发者更好地掌握这一实用工具。
微信小程序轮播图的实现原理
微信小程序轮播图的核心在于通过预设的图片序列和自动播放机制,结合用户交互操作,实现图片的流畅切换和展示,开发者需要借助微信小程序提供的API和组件,如swiper和swiper-item,来构建轮播图功能,通过这些组件,开发者可以轻松实现图片的自动播放、手动切换以及分页加载等特性,从而为用户带来丰富的视觉体验。
微信小程序轮播图的功能特点
-
丰富多样的模板选择:微信小程序为轮播图提供了多种内置模板,如圆形、方形等,以满足不同场景下的设计需求,开发者还可以根据自身喜好,自定义轮播图的样式和布局,使其更加符合应用的整体风格。
-
灵活的图片切换效果:通过自定义轮播图切换动画,如淡入淡出、滑动等,开发者可以营造出独特的视觉效果,提升用户体验,微信小程序还支持预加载图片,以减少切换时的等待时刻,进步流畅度。
-
智能的自动播放与手动控制:轮播图可以设置为自动播放模式,根据预设的时刻间隔自动切换图片,用户还可以通过点击或触摸操作手动控制轮播图的切换,增加了交互的灵活性和趣味性。
-
强大的分页功能:当轮播图中的图片数量较多时,微信小程序提供了分页功能,允许用户通过左右滑动手势来切换到下一页或上一页,方便用户浏览更多内容。
优化策略
-
图片优化:为了确保轮播图的快速加载和流畅展示,开发者应尽量选择高质量、低分辨率的图片,并对其进行适当的压缩处理,还可以考虑使用雪碧图(CSS Sprites)技术,将多张图片合并成一张图片,以减少HTTP请求次数和进步加载速度。
-
性能优化:在轮播图的实现经过中,应注意避免不必要的重绘和回流操作,减少页面的复杂度,合理使用缓存机制,避免重复加载已加载过的图片资源。
-
用户体验优化:在设计轮播图时,应充分考虑用户的视觉习性和操作习性,确保图片切换的流畅性和天然性,还可以添加一些辅助功能,如显示当前图片的深入了解或标签信息,帮助用户更好地领会图片内容。
-
响应式设计:为了适应不同设备和屏幕尺寸,开发者应采用响应式设计策略,使轮播图能够自适应不同的屏幕大致和分辨率,通过使用相对单位(如百分比)而非完全单位(如像素),可以确保轮播图的布局在不同设备上都能保持良好的视觉效果。
微信小程序轮播图作为一种强大的展示工具,为开发者提供了丰富的实现可能和优化空间,通过深入了解轮播图的原理、特点以及优化策略,开发者可以更好地利用这一工具,为用户带来更加生动、有趣且高效的使用体验。
就是关于微信小程序轮播图的介绍,由本站独家整理,来源网络、网友投稿以及本站原创。
